#748757 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#748757 is composed of 45.5% red, 52.9%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.6%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 83.8 degrees, a saturation of 21.6% and a lightness of 43.5%. #748757 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8ffae with #000f00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#748757 color description : Mostly desaturated dark green.
#748757 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#748757 has RGB values of R:116, G:135,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 7636823.

Shades and Tints of #748757
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030402 is the darkest color, while #f9faf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#748757
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707668 is the less saturated color, while #86dc02 is the most saturated one.
